“Went there for the first time and was very surprised. The sourdough cream cheese donut was excellent. The matcha latte was great too, very good latte art. Not the greatest fan of the cherry cake donut.
We came back a second time the next day and tried their coffee, whilst it doesnt taste as good as Australian coffee, its definitely one of the better ones in the USA that we’ve had. We tried the mocha donut and it was fairly good, lil on the sweet side. But the sourdough donut was excellent again, highly recommend. Overall great place to chill, study, have good donuts and decent coffee.“

“I love Mochi Mochi donuts! I was glad to see that they had a small display at the Bryant St. Market. Mochi Mochi donuts are a perfect pillowy, scalloped-edged donut available in unique and traditional flavors.
I usually get the mango or yuzu flavored donuts when I order them from the spot food hall in Rockville.
The day that I went to Mochi Mochi, their menu was pretty extensive given that it’s a small display seemingly within the poke shop.
I chose the churro flavor and a strawberry for a friend. The churro donut was basically the donut version of the churro sprinkled with cinnamon sugar and lightly fried. It was good.
My friend said that the Mochi Mochi strawberry donut was delicious. When I purchased it, the young lady said that it was a strawberry donut with strawberry glaze and topped with freeze-dried strawberries. If you love strawberries, this sounds like a great choice.
Definitively check them out the next time you’re at Bryant St.“
